What is the Daintree Rainforest?
The Daintree Rainforest is one of the world’s oldest tropical rainforests and a UNESCO World Heritage-listed ecosystem located in tropical North Queensland. The rainforest is known for its incredible biodiversity, ancient plant species, unique wildlife, and lush tropical landscapes. Visitors can explore rainforest trails, rivers, and scenic viewpoints throughout the region. The Daintree is considered one of Australia’s most important natural environments. It is home to many rare and endemic species.
What is Cape Tribulation famous for?
Cape Tribulation is famous for being one of the few places in the world where the rainforest meets the reef. The area features beautiful tropical beaches, dense rainforest scenery, and spectacular coastal landscapes. Visitors often enjoy walking along the beach, exploring rainforest trails, and experiencing the natural beauty of the region. The area is popular for eco-tourism and wildlife observation. Cape Tribulation is one of the top nature destinations near Cairns.
